Abstract
The American School Counselor Association calls for counselors to utilize multitiered systems of support to minimize gaps. Specifically, Tier 2 interventions provide a method to address equity issues and foster growth. Black male students experience the greatest disparities in schools; therefore, school counselors should consider culturally affirming, strengths-based groups to meet these students’ needs. This practitioner research outlines an intervention resulting in participants’ decreased discipline referrals and enhanced social/emotional skills.
